About 5,6-bis(ethenyl)pyridine-3-carbonyl fluoride
5,6-bis(ethenyl)pyridine-3-carbonyl fluoride (PubChem CID 143985107) has the molecular formula C10H8FNO
and a molecular weight of 177.18 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 5,6-bis(ethenyl)pyridine-3-carbonyl fluoride.
